Attack on Saudi Pipeline

THE WAR ROOM: Saudi Arabia shut down a critical oil pipeline across the Arabian peninsula following a drone attack on the pipe, causing the barrel price of oil to briefly jump to $110.

  The attack came from Iraqi territory but is believed to have been launched by some kind of Iranian affiliate. Iraq asked Saudi Arabia not to retaliate while they investigate who did it.

  The Saudi pipeline attack and shutdown has the potential to seriously raise the price of oil. Saudi oil shipments are squeezed to the west on the Persian Gulf by the war with Iran, and now in the east by movements of Houthi rebels in Yemen putting the pinch on the entryway to the Red Sea.

ECON 101: The price of diesel fuel has reached an average of $6 a gallon, a significant development that will ripple through the economy as the cost of transporting goods rises.

  The NY Times published an online graphic tracking the spike in prices for basic goods in just the past few years. A pound of steak that was $8 in 2019 is $13 now. Beef is up 96 percent since 2012 and bread is up 46 percent over that same period.

  Interestingly, clothing is up only 9 percent since 2012 and appliances are actually down 3 percent.

GETTING TO THE BOTTOM OF IT: The contractor who refurbished the Lincoln memorial reflecting pool says that the failure of the bottom surfacing was the result of errors in workmanship and materials, not vandalism as President Trump has repeatedly claimed.

  Atlantic Industrial Coatings in an August 14th report admitted problems in both the design and the execution of the renovation, according to documents reviewed by the NY Times. The Justice Department filed charges against several people accusing them of vandalizing the pool, and later dismissed them.

  Atlantic admits that workers did not properly apply the primer that would make the “American Flag Blue” liner stick to the bottom. The company also said that the repair plan laid out in the contract called for the layers of liner to include two chemicals that turned out to be incompatible.

  The company is repairing the pool under warranty and President Trump has not withdrawn his claims that the peeling bottom coating was the result of vandalism.
